What is Glacial Acetic Acid?


Glacial acetic acid (chemical formula CH₃COOH) is a colorless liquid organic compound that is the simplest carboxylic acid. It is called glacial because of its ability to solidify at low temperatures, forming ice-like crystals. In its pure form, glacial acetic acid has a pungent smell and is highly corrosive. It is typically used in concentrations greater than 99%, distinguishing it from diluted forms of acetic acid, such as vinegar.


The primary production method for glacial acetic acid is through the carbonylation of methanol, which converts methanol and carbon monoxide into acetic acid using a catalyst. This industrial process allows for efficient production, making glacial acetic acid readily available for various applications.


Applications of Glacial Acetic Acid


Glacial acetic acid serves myriad purposes across various sectors


1. Chemical Manufacturing It is a key precursor in the production of acetate esters, which are used in solvents, coatings, and plastics. 2. Food Industry In the food sector, it acts as a preservative and is often used in pickling processes. It is also a key component in certain food flavorings. 3. Pharmaceuticals Glacial acetic acid is utilized in the synthesis of several pharmaceuticals and as a solvent in drug formulations.


4. Textiles The textile industry uses acetic acid in the production of synthetic fibers such as rayon and in dyeing processes.


5. Agriculture It serves as a herbicide and is often employed in agricultural applications for weed management.

Importance of HS Code for Glacial Acetic Acid


The Harmonized System (HS) Code is an internationally standardized system of names and numbers used to classify traded products. The HS code for glacial acetic acid typically falls under the broader category of organic chemicals. Specifically, it is classified under


HS Code 2915.21 - This code corresponds to acetic acid, including glacial acetic acid.


Understanding HS codes is essential for businesses engaged in international trade, as it facilitates the seamless movement of goods across borders. It helps in assessing tariffs, inventory management, and compliance with trade regulations. Proper classification under the HS Code is crucial for avoiding customs issues and ensuring that proper duties and taxes are paid.


Global Trade Implications


The global market for glacial acetic acid is substantial, with major producers located in regions such as Asia, Europe, and North America. Countries like China and the United States are prominent players in its production and exportation. The demand is driven by the growing applications of glacial acetic acid in various industries, notably in chemicals and textiles.


Trade agreements and international regulations can significantly affect the pricing and availability of glacial acetic acid. For instance, any changes in tariffs due to trade disputes can impact downstream industries reliant on this essential chemical. Businesses must stay informed about international trade policies and market trends to navigate potential challenges effectively.
